Idiopathic Acute Eosinophilic Pneumonia.
Jean Bergounioux1, Alice Hadchouel2, Laure De Saint Blanca1
1Pediatric Intensive Care, Hôpital Universitaire Necker Enfants Malades, AP-HP, Paris, France.
Idiopathic acute eosinophilic pneumonia (IAEP) in children presents with hypoxia and lung infiltrates. Prompt steroid treatment leads to full recovery, highlighting its importance in pediatric respiratory emergencies.
Area of Science:
- Pediatric Pulmonology
- Critical Care Medicine
- Rare Respiratory Diseases
Background:
- Idiopathic acute eosinophilic pneumonia (IAEP) is a rare but serious condition in children.
- It presents as febrile hypoxic respiratory failure with lung infiltrates and eosinophilia.
- Early diagnosis and treatment are crucial to prevent severe lung injury.
Purpose of the Study:
- To describe a case of IAEP in a previously healthy adolescent.
- To highlight the diagnostic challenges and approach for IAEP in children.
- To emphasize the efficacy of corticosteroid treatment for IAEP.
Main Methods:
- Case report of a 14-year-old boy with IAEP.
- Review of clinical presentation, radiographic findings, and bronchoalveolar lavage results.
- Assessment of treatment response to corticosteroids.
Main Results:
- The patient presented with acute hypoxia and characteristic findings.
- Diagnosis was confirmed after excluding other causes.
- Full recovery was achieved following corticosteroid therapy.
Conclusions:
- IAEP is an uncommon but treatable cause of acute respiratory failure in children.
- A high index of suspicion and prompt exclusion of other diagnoses are necessary.
- Corticosteroids are effective in managing IAEP, leading to complete recovery.
